Box Breathing - sometimes referred to as Square Breathing or 4-4-4-4 Breathing - is a great tool to calm nerves and ease anxiety! Become mesmerized by the magical hot air balloon while regulating the nervous system. What are the benefits of box breathing? When we are anxious, our breath tends to shorten and become more shallow. Box breathing encourages slow deep breathing, which can help reduce stress, regulate the nervous system, and calm the mind during moments of panic. Watch the hot air balloon travel in the shape of a square. When the hot air balloon travels up the side of the square you breath in for 4 counts, when it travels across the top of the square you hold your breath for 4 counts, when the hot air balloon travels down the other side of the square you breath out fully for 4 counts and then when it moves back to the beginning of the square you pause again for 4 counts. By watching the hot air balloon move you will have a better visual image in your head that you can then recall at any moment of the day when you might need it.
